What's the name and location of the cafe in van gogh's cafe terrace by night painting?

The painting is of a real French cafe, now renamed Cafe Van Gogh. The cafe is in the city of Arles, France. This painting is the first showing a "starry night." The second is a painting showing the night sky over the Rhone River Bridge, also in Arles. The third, and most famous "Starry Night," now in the Museum of Modern Art in New York City, was painted in St. Remy, France when Van Gogh was in the sanitarium there.

Is Cafe Terrace at night is an impressionism art?

"Café Terrace at Night," painted by Vincent van Gogh in 1888, is often categorized within the Post-Impressionism movement rather than Impressionism itself. While it shares characteristics with Impressionism, such as vibrant color and expressive brushwork, Post-Impressionism moves beyond the immediate effects of light and atmosphere to convey deeper emotional and symbolic meanings. Van Gogh's use of color and form in this work reflects his unique style that distinguishes him from traditional Impressionist artists.
